The role involves developing a web application, improving core systems, and collaborating with peers to translate business needs into technical solutions, along with guiding junior engineers.
Northwestern Mutual (NM) has been helping families and businesses achieve financial security for over 160 years. Through a distinctive, whole-picture planning approach including both insurance and investments, we empower people to be financially confident. We combine the expertise of our financial professionals with a personalized digital experience and leading-edge technology to best serve our clients.
Our Software Engineering team at Northwestern Mutual is responsible for developing and enhancing systems that enable the company to fulfill its financial commitments to its customers, employees, and field representatives. These systems are financial in nature, centered on risk products, and based on the professional knowledge of the actuary. The applications vary in scope, are generally mathematical in nature, and require collaboration with both technical peers and business experts. The assignment will be a full stack engineer on an agile team developing a web application to maintain data related to Reinsurance and supported by the Actuarial Software Engineering team. You'll be part of a team that plays a crucial role in ensuring this company continues to do great things for its customers.
Primary Duties & Responsibilities
Requirements:
Technical Skills:
Full Stack developer with:
Benefits:
Compensation Range:
Pay Range - Start:
$102,060.00
Pay Range - End:
$189,540.00
Geographic Specific Pay Structure:
Structure 110:
$112,280.00 USD - $208,520.00 USD
Structure 115:
$117,390.00 USD - $218,010.00 USD
We believe in fairness and transparency. It's why we share the salary range for most of our roles. However, final salaries are based on a number of factors, including the skills and experience of the candidate; the current market; location of the candidate; and other factors uncovered in the hiring process. The standard pay structure is listed but if you're living in California, New York City or other eligible location, geographic specific pay structures, compensation and benefits could be applicable, click here to learn more.
Grow your career with a best-in-class company that puts our clients' interests at the center of all we do. Get started now!
Northwestern Mutual is an equal opportunity employer who welcomes and encourages diversity in the workforce. We are committed to creating and maintaining an environment in which each employee can contribute creative ideas, seek challenges, assume leadership and continue to focus on meeting and exceeding business and personal objectives.
FIND YOUR FUTURE
We're excited about the potential people bring to Northwestern Mutual. You can grow your career here while enjoying first-class perks, benefits, and our commitment to a culture of belonging.
Our Software Engineering team at Northwestern Mutual is responsible for developing and enhancing systems that enable the company to fulfill its financial commitments to its customers, employees, and field representatives. These systems are financial in nature, centered on risk products, and based on the professional knowledge of the actuary. The applications vary in scope, are generally mathematical in nature, and require collaboration with both technical peers and business experts. The assignment will be a full stack engineer on an agile team developing a web application to maintain data related to Reinsurance and supported by the Actuarial Software Engineering team. You'll be part of a team that plays a crucial role in ensuring this company continues to do great things for its customers.
Primary Duties & Responsibilities
- Leverage technical experience to develop, create, and implement a software user interface that meets business needs
- Strive to continually improve our core systems, with a focus on delivering excellence to the business experts who rely on your work
- Work with subject matter experts and technical peers to translate business needs into software engineering projects
- Provide guidance and leadership to less experienced software engineers
- Multiply the talent of your teammates by sharing your experiences and learnings and fostering a positive team focused atmosphere
Requirements:
- Bachelor's degree or equivalent experience
- 5+ years of professional experience in a software engineering or application development role
- Experience developing solutions using agile methods, with a focus on client needs
- Capable of communicating well with technical peers and business side experts
- Ability to perform peer reviews on design and resulting code
- Solid understanding of system design patterns and architectural concepts
Technical Skills:
Full Stack developer with:
- Strong working knowledge of React, HTML5, CSS, functional components, hooks, Redux.
- NodeJS with Javascript, NodeJS with Typescript or Java Spring Boot
- Experience with DevOps and Git.
- Relational and non-relational database knowledge and experience.
- Experience with Postgres and DynamoDB preferred.
- Strong problem-solving skills
- Ability to effectively communicate technical topics to both technical teams and non-technical teams
Benefits:
- Tuition reimbursement, commuter plans, and paid time off
- Highly competitive compensation that include base salary plus bonus
- Medical/Dental/Vision plans, 401(k), pension program
Compensation Range:
Pay Range - Start:
$102,060.00
Pay Range - End:
$189,540.00
Geographic Specific Pay Structure:
Structure 110:
$112,280.00 USD - $208,520.00 USD
Structure 115:
$117,390.00 USD - $218,010.00 USD
We believe in fairness and transparency. It's why we share the salary range for most of our roles. However, final salaries are based on a number of factors, including the skills and experience of the candidate; the current market; location of the candidate; and other factors uncovered in the hiring process. The standard pay structure is listed but if you're living in California, New York City or other eligible location, geographic specific pay structures, compensation and benefits could be applicable, click here to learn more.
Grow your career with a best-in-class company that puts our clients' interests at the center of all we do. Get started now!
Northwestern Mutual is an equal opportunity employer who welcomes and encourages diversity in the workforce. We are committed to creating and maintaining an environment in which each employee can contribute creative ideas, seek challenges, assume leadership and continue to focus on meeting and exceeding business and personal objectives.
FIND YOUR FUTURE
We're excited about the potential people bring to Northwestern Mutual. You can grow your career here while enjoying first-class perks, benefits, and our commitment to a culture of belonging.
- Flexible work schedules
- Concierge service
- Comprehensive benefits
- Employee resource groups
Top Skills
CSS
DevOps
DynamoDB
Git
HTML5
Java Spring Boot
JavaScript
Node.js
Postgres
React
Redux
Typescript
Similar Jobs at Northwestern Mutual
Fintech • Insurance • Financial Services
Lead engineering, product, and tech teams to deliver value and drive change. Collaborate across functions to ensure alignment with business strategy and advocate for digital transformation.
Top Skills:
Digital TransformationEngineeringProduct DevelopmentTechnology Delivery
Fintech • Insurance • Financial Services
Lead engineering, product, and technology teams to drive digital transformation, manage budgets, and advocate for innovation and continuous learning.
Top Skills:
EngineeringProduct DevelopmentTechnology Delivery
Fintech • Insurance • Financial Services
The Workday Configuration Lead will manage the Workday team, oversee Talent Management projects, and ensure effective system solutions and data integrity.
Top Skills:
Workday
What you need to know about the Boston Tech Scene
Boston is a powerhouse for technology innovation thanks to world-class research universities like MIT and Harvard and a robust pipeline of venture capital investment. Host to the first telephone call and one of the first general-purpose computers ever put into use, Boston is now a hub for biotechnology, robotics and artificial intelligence — though it’s also home to several B2B software giants. So it’s no surprise that the city consistently ranks among the greatest startup ecosystems in the world.
Key Facts About Boston Tech
- Number of Tech Workers: 269,000; 9.4% of overall workforce (2024 CompTIA survey)
- Major Tech Employers: Thermo Fisher Scientific, Toast, Klaviyo, HubSpot, DraftKings
- Key Industries: Artificial intelligence, biotechnology, robotics, software, aerospace
- Funding Landscape: $15.7 billion in venture capital funding in 2024 (Pitchbook)
- Notable Investors: Summit Partners, Volition Capital, Bain Capital Ventures, MassVentures, Highland Capital Partners
- Research Centers and Universities: MIT, Harvard University, Boston College, Tufts University, Boston University, Northeastern University, Smithsonian Astrophysical Observatory, National Bureau of Economic Research, Broad Institute, Lowell Center for Space Science & Technology, National Emerging Infectious Diseases Laboratories

